![]() Our PropertiesAscott JakartaTransportationBecaksA becak is a tricycle, which is pedalled by a man where one or two passengers sit in front. This transport has been around for 40 years, but is slowly disappearing. Agree on the fare with the driver before he begins the journey. BusesThere are three main terminals in Jakarta servicing inter-cities. Some buses are air-conditioned; choose only Patas (express) buses, if possible. Damri buses run every 30 – 60 minutes to five city terminals. Fare is around 4,000 rupiahs and the journey takes around 45 – 60 minutes. Cars & MotorcyclesThere are several car rental companies around and motorbikes for rent also. A license is needed to rent and driving is on the left. Chauffeur is optional. FlightsThere are several domestic airlines (Merpati, Bouraq, Mandala & Lion Air) and national carrier, Garuda operating on domestic routes that has several flights daily to destinations such as Bali, Medan and Manado. Shuttle flights to Surabaya and Semarang are also available. TaxisAll licensed taxis run by meters. For safety concerns, it is advisable to only take Silver Bird or Blue Bird taxis. If travelling from the airport, an airport surcharge and toll road will be added to the fare. |
